Description
In the midst of lost certainties, there is no room for doubt. As the forces of the anti-democratic world outside of Europe strengthen and the socio-economic model of extreme marketization is established within the community, the European, a place of democratic social organization par excellence, is shrinking. The expansion of democracy from politics to the economy, "an incomplete program that fascism fully abolished," as Polanyi points out, continues to be suspended.
Not long before the pandemic crisis and the invasion of Ukraine, the interpretation of the crisis in the common currency zone and its management seemed to have determined the process of European integration on a specific trajectory of development, dictating a specific way of social organization. This commitment, so palpable in Greece, is the subject of this monograph. Beyond the framework of a conjunctural crisis in the global economy, beyond the framework of the known perennial imperfections of the European construction or the perennial pathologies of our country, the mechanism of this commitment, its form, intensity, and consequences, the relevant resistances and the prospects it now sets in motion are identified, highlighted, and interpreted in eleven chapters.
